Maintenance Tech II

The Maintenance Technician II provides assistance in maintaining the property, plant and equipment of the facility.

Maintains mechanical and electrical equipment in operable conditions.

Performs maintenance tasks in accordance with procedures and preventative maintenance schedule.

Responds to maintenance requests by Residents and Staff.

Maintains storage and mechanical areas in clean, orderly manner.

Assists in removal of trash and debris.Maintains interior and exterior of all buildings.

Maintains inventory of maintenance supplies.

Constructs, repairs and maintains structures; such as, equipment, partitions and other parts of buildings, using hand and power tools according to written and oral instructions.

Performs electrical, carpentry, HVAC, painting, plaster, repairs and plumbing tasks as directed.

Performs periodic inspections of property, plant and equipment.Performs landscaping and grounds maintenance tasks including mowing, hedging, weeding, spreading fertilizer, mulch, sowing grass, setting out plants, watering, trimming of trees and shrubs.

Participates in safety, fire control, security and other matters related to Life and Safety Codes.

Assists in maintaining, cleaning and inspecting company motor vehicles.

Minimal Education:

High school diploma or GED required.
Formal education in a trade related field such as HVAC, Electrical Installation and Maintenance required (requirement may be waived for individuals with extensive on the job experience).

Minimal Experience:

A minimum of five years experience as a maintenance technician preferably in the health care setting.

A minimum of two years experience in the health care setting required.

Other Qualifications:

Have or have the ability to receive training and be certified by the State of Refrigeration Examiners for the use and proper handling of refrigerants.

Valid driver's license, and ability to meet EveryAge's auto insurance carrier's standards for coverage.
